Ticket sales for the music festival of indigenous people, Ijahis idja, have started today. Advance tickets can be purchased at lippu.fi and at Lippupiste locations.

The price of an advance ticket for the whole weekend is €69.60 for adults and €22.60 for a children’s (7-15 years old) advance ticket.

The advance price of a day ticket purchased in advance for adults is €38.59 and for children €11.59.

Advance ticket prices include lippu.fi’s service fee, €1.60-€4.60. The lippu.fi ordering fee and a possible delivery fee depending on the delivery method will be added to the price. The prices of the tickets sold at the gate are €80 for a weekend ticket for adults and €25 for children, and €45 for a day ticket for adults and €15 for children.

Children under the age of 7 can enter the event for free.

We urge people to buy a ticket in advance and to use a card as a means of payment when buying at the gate. You can also pay in cash at the gate.

Ijahis idja will be organized in Inari on August 15.-16., 2025. The performers are Ella Marie, Mollet, Hildá Länsman & Tuomas Norvio, Yunmiqu, Kajsa Balto, Áššu, Karjalasta kolttien maille, Ante Aikio & Nilla Länsman, Jussen Ántte Sálmmo Ánná Máret & Guhtur Biera Jovnna Mauri Petra and in the traditional Sámi music concert Anna Morottaja, Beaska Niillas and Sárá Nilut. 

The program also includes a craft market, a lasso throwing competition and a Talent stage. All Ijahis idja festival wristbands also provide a free entry to the Sámi Museum Siida’s exhibitions during the festival weekend (Fri-Sun).

On Thursday, August 14, 2025, there will be a free Ijahis idja pre-party with Ellinor Halvari at Wilderness Hotel Juutua. The age limit for the pre-party is 18.
